Charles de Meillon

After matriculating from Reddam House in Cape Town, Charles de Meillon went on to achieve an LLB at the University of the Free State and a post graduate certification in business rescue at UNISA whilst working part-time as an operational manager at a fine-dining restaurant. He has also provided ad hoc compliance, due diligence and contract work to various clients over the years.

De Meillon is currently working as a candidate attorney at Gillan & Veldhuizen Inc. in its corporate, commercial and conveyancing departments.
